.. AUTO-GENERATED FILE. DO NOT EDIT. post-equipments-create ====================== Source ------ - Repository: ``jef-systems/jef-caferimo-backend`` - Module: ``caferimo`` - Documentation Scope: ``async`` - Lambda: ``jef-caferimo-post-3`` Endpoint -------- - API Name: ``jef-caferimo`` - Action Name: ``post`` - Method: ``POST`` - Scope Label: ``Async`` - Resource Path: ``/post-equipments-create`` - Complete Endpoint: ``https://lfyr4e0eqe.execute-api.ap-southeast-1.amazonaws.com/prod/post-equipments-create`` - Lambda ARN: ``arn:aws:lambda:ap-southeast-1:246715082475:function:jef-caferimo-post-3`` - curl payload mode: ``json_body`` API Gateway Description ----------------------- .. code-block:: text Function: jef-caferimo-post-3 API Name: jef-caferimo Action: post Method: POST Resource Path: /post-equipments-create Payload: - entity_number: string-4-digits-nonzerostart - asset_number: string - asset_name: string - category: string - status: string-enum-active-maintenance-retired - notes: string-optional Response: - exists: boolean - message: string - item: {"pk":"string-{entity_number}#{asset_number}","gsi_1_pk":"string-{entity_number}#{category}","gsi_1_sk":"string-asset_name","entity_number":"string-4-digits-nonzerostart","asset_number":"string","asset_name":"string","category":"string","status":"string-enum-active-maintenance-retired","notes":"string-optional"} Request Payload --------------- .. code-block:: json { "entity_number": "string-4-digits-nonzerostart", "asset_number": "string", "asset_name": "string", "category": "string", "status": "string-enum-active-maintenance-retired", "notes": "string-optional" } Response -------- .. code-block:: json { "exists": "boolean", "message": "string", "item": "{\"pk\":\"string-{entity_number}#{asset_number}\",\"gsi_1_pk\":\"string-{entity_number}#{category}\",\"gsi_1_sk\":\"string-asset_name\",\"entity_number\":\"string-4-digits-nonzerostart\",\"asset_number\":\"string\",\"asset_name\":\"string\",\"category\":\"string\",\"status\":\"string-enum-active-maintenance-retired\",\"notes\":\"string-optional\"}" } CMD curl -------- .. code-block:: text curl -X POST "https://lfyr4e0eqe.execute-api.ap-southeast-1.amazonaws.com/prod/post-equipments-create" -H "Content-Type: application/json" --data-raw "{\"entity_number\": \"string-4-digits-nonzerostart\", \"asset_number\": \"string\", \"asset_name\": \"string\", \"category\": \"string\", \"status\": \"string-enum-active-maintenance-retired\", \"notes\": \"string-optional\"}" PowerShell curl --------------- .. code-block:: text curl.exe -X POST "https://lfyr4e0eqe.execute-api.ap-southeast-1.amazonaws.com/prod/post-equipments-create" -H "Content-Type: application/json" --data-raw '{"entity_number": "string-4-digits-nonzerostart", "asset_number": "string", "asset_name": "string", "category": "string", "status": "string-enum-active-maintenance-retired", "notes": "string-optional"}'